From e9839fc2d91e9bb151d2b10539ad2a8d8df24df7 Mon Sep 17 00:00:00 2001 From: Toni de la Fuente Date: Thu, 6 Oct 2016 13:56:50 -0400 Subject: [PATCH] Fixed issue in check 1.10 --- prowler |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/prowler b/prowler index a79c3bd290..e9abf5b8e8 100755 --- a/prowler +++ b/prowler @@ -368,14 +368,16 @@ check19(){ check110(){ TITLE110="$BLUE 1.10$NORMAL Ensure IAM password policy prevents password reuse (Scored)" - COMMAND110=$($AWSCLI iam get-account-password-policy --profile $PROFILE --region $REGION --query 'PasswordPolicy.PasswordReusePrevention' | grep PasswordReusePrevention | awk -F: '{ print $2 }'|sed 's/\ //g'|sed 's/,/ /g') + COMMAND110=$($AWSCLI iam get-account-password-policy --profile $PROFILE --region $REGION --query 'PasswordPolicy.PasswordReusePrevention' --output text) echo -e "\n$TITLE110 " if [[ $COMMAND110 ]];then if [[ $COMMAND110 -gt "23" ]];then echo -e " $OK OK $NORMAL" + else + echo -e " $RED WARNING! It is not set or it is set lower than 24 $NORMAL" fi else - echo -e " $RED FALSE $NORMAL" + echo -e " $RED WARNING! It is not set $NORMAL" fi }